お知らせ • Jan 23One Liberty Properties, Inc. (NYSE:OLP) completed the acquisition of Two industrial properties located in Theodore, Alabama.One Liberty Properties, Inc. (NYSE:OLP) agreed to acquire Two industrial properties located in Theodore, Alabama for $49 million on November 19, 2024. The aggregate annual base rent is approximately $3.1 million, with annual rental increases generally ranging from 2.3% to 3.5%, and the weighted average remaining lease term is approximately seven years. The consideration is expect to finance the acquisition with cash and a ten-year $29 million mortgage (interest only for five years and then amortizing on a 30 year schedule) bearing an interest rate of 6.12%. Completion of the transaction is subject to customary conditions, including the completion, to satisfaction, of due diligence investigation. The will be completed in early 2025. One Liberty Properties, Inc. (NYSE:OLP) completed the acquisition of Two industrial properties located in Theodore, Alabama on January 22, 2025.

お知らせ • Dec 22An unknown buyer completed the acquisition of three restaurant properties and two retail properties in United State from One Liberty Properties, Inc. (NYSE:OLP).An unknown buyer entered into non-cancellable agreements to acquire three restaurant properties and two retail properties in United States from One Liberty Properties, Inc. (NYSE:OLP) for $23 million on November 30, 2023. The sale includes Applebees restaurants in Lawrenceville, Cartersville, and Cartersville, Georgia and Barnes & Noble retail property in Fort Myers, Florida and Havertys retail property in Virginia Beach, Virginia. In a related transaction, an unknown buyer acquired two restaurant properties and a portion of a retail property from One Liberty Properties, Inc. for $8.7 million. One Liberty Properties anticipates that these sales will be completed before year-end of 2023. On December 5, 2023, Applebees restaurant in Carrolton and Cartersville were sold; On December 7, Applebees restaurant in Lawrenceville was sold. On December 15, 2023, One Liberty Properties completed on the sale of Havertys retail property. One Liberty Properties anticipates using the estimated net proceeds ranging from approximately $19 million to $21 million from the sales of the five properties subject to the non-cancellable agreements to pay-off the balance of the credit facility debt, for general working capital purposes and as appropriate, pay-off mortgage debt or repurchase company stock.An unknown buyer completed the acquisition of three restaurant properties and two retail properties in United State from One Liberty Properties, Inc. (NYSE:OLP) on December 21, 2023. One Liberty Properties estimates it will receive approximately $19 million of net proceeds from these sales. One Liberty Properties anticipates that the approximate $19 million sales’ proceeds balance will be used for general working capital purposes and, as market conditions warrant, to acquire properties, reduce mortgage debt and repurchase Company stock. In the short term, One Liberty Properties anticipates investing the sale proceeds in short-term Treasury bills.
